#41f656 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#41f656 is composed of 25.5% red, 96.5%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 65%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 127 degrees, a saturation of 91% and a lightness of 61%. #41f656 color hex could be obtained by blending #82ffac with #00ed00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#41f656 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#41f656 has RGB values of R:65, G:246,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 4322902.
